Understanding Inverter Output Voltage 157V: Applications and Technical Insights
Why Inverter Output Voltage 157V Matters in Modern Energy Systems
Inverter output voltage 157V has become a critical parameter in renewable energy systems, particularly for solar and hybrid storage solutions. This voltage range balances efficiency and compatibility, making it ideal for both residential and industrial applications. Imagine your energy system as a highway – 157V acts like a "speed limit" that optimizes power flow without overloading components.
Key Applications of 157V Inverters
- Solar energy storage: Matches panel arrays for reduced conversion losses
- Industrial UPS systems: Provides stable backup power for machinery
- EV charging stations: Supports fast-charging infrastructure development
